Zanubrutinib API market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 18.6% between 2025 and 2035. The market growth is driven by rising incidences of B-cell malignancies such as ch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L), mantle cell lymphoma (MCL), and Waldenström’s macroglobulinemia (WM). Zanubrutinib, a next-generation Bruton’s tyrosine kinase (BTK) inhibitor, has gained widespread acceptance for its improved selectivity and safety profile.

The largest segment by application is ch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L), supported by an aging global population and increasing diagnosis rates of hematological malignancies. Pharmaceutical companies remain the primary end-users, accounting for over 65% of total API consumption, particularly innovator firms and generic players preparing for market entry post-patent expiry. Additionally, Contract Development and Manufacturing Organizations (CDMOs) are gaining traction due to the industry’s increasing inclination toward outsourcing API production to reduce costs and accelerate time-to-market.

Geographically, China holds a dominant position in the zanubrutinib API market due to the presence of BeiGene, the drug’s innovator and a major global supplier. Furthermore, China’s strong API manufacturing infrastructure and government support for biopharma innovation bolster its leading role. India is another critical player, serving as a hub for cost-effective API production and export, especially among generic drug manufacturers targeting regulated markets like the U.S. and EU. The United States remains the top consumer due to high prescription rates and regulatory approvals from the FDA.

Major players in the Zanubrutinib API market include BeiGene, WuXi AppTec, Pfizer CentreOne, Dr. Reddy’s Laboratories, and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d. These companies are actively investing in R&D, regulatory filings, and production scalability to meet growing global demand.

1. What is Zanubrutinib?
Zanubrutinib is a next-generation Bruton’s tyrosine kinase (BTK) inhibitor used primarily to treat B-cell malignancies like chronic lymphocytic leukemia and mantle cell lymphoma. It offers improved selectivity and fewer off-target effects compared to earlier BTK inhibitors.
